Code:
/ 4.0 / 4.0 / DEVDIV_TFS / Dev10 / Releases / RTMRel / ndp / fx / src / Data / System / Data / Common / DbTransaction.cs / 1305376 / DbTransaction.cs
//------------------------------------------------------------------------------
//
// Copyright (c) Microsoft Corporation. All rights reserved.
//
// [....]
// [....]
//-----------------------------------------------------------------------------
namespace System.Data.Common {
using System;
using System.Data;
public abstract class DbTransaction : MarshalByRefObject, IDbTransaction { // V1.2.3300
protected DbTransaction() : base() {
}
public DbConnection Connection {
get {
return DbConnection;
}
}
IDbConnection IDbTransaction.Connection {
get {
return DbConnection;
}
}
abstract protected DbConnection DbConnection {
get;
}
abstract public IsolationLevel IsolationLevel {
get;
}
abstract public void Commit();
public void Dispose() {
Dispose(true);
}
protected virtual void Dispose(bool disposing) {
}
abstract public void Rollback();
}
}
// File provided for Reference Use Only by Microsoft Corporation (c) 2007.
//------------------------------------------------------------------------------
//
// Copyright (c) Microsoft Corporation. All rights reserved.
//
// [....]
// [....]
//-----------------------------------------------------------------------------
namespace System.Data.Common {
using System;
using System.Data;
public abstract class DbTransaction : MarshalByRefObject, IDbTransaction { // V1.2.3300
protected DbTransaction() : base() {
}
public DbConnection Connection {
get {
return DbConnection;
}
}
IDbConnection IDbTransaction.Connection {
get {
return DbConnection;
}
}
abstract protected DbConnection DbConnection {
get;
}
abstract public IsolationLevel IsolationLevel {
get;
}
abstract public void Commit();
public void Dispose() {
Dispose(true);
}
protected virtual void Dispose(bool disposing) {
}
abstract public void Rollback();
}
}
// File provided for Reference Use Only by Microsoft Corporation (c) 2007.
Link Menu

This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- Icon.cs
- PackWebResponse.cs
- EmptyEnumerator.cs
- SafeFileMappingHandle.cs
- LinearGradientBrush.cs
- ConfigurationSectionCollection.cs
- UIElementHelper.cs
- WinInet.cs
- serverconfig.cs
- SByte.cs
- TrustSection.cs
- CurrentChangingEventManager.cs
- CodeConstructor.cs
- GenericEnumConverter.cs
- ReadOnlyDictionary.cs
- FullTextState.cs
- JsonGlobals.cs
- XmlBoundElement.cs
- Sentence.cs
- SettingsBindableAttribute.cs
- WebControl.cs
- wgx_sdk_version.cs
- Convert.cs
- QueryOperationResponseOfT.cs
- MarkerProperties.cs
- CompressStream.cs
- CustomWebEventKey.cs
- Attributes.cs
- EntityDataSourceViewSchema.cs
- AuthStoreRoleProvider.cs
- TCPClient.cs
- SettingsAttributes.cs
- SqlDelegatedTransaction.cs
- LogicalCallContext.cs
- SmtpTransport.cs
- QueryAccessibilityHelpEvent.cs
- Keyboard.cs
- ExpressionPrefixAttribute.cs
- Highlights.cs
- TracedNativeMethods.cs
- DataGridParentRows.cs
- GenericPrincipal.cs
- PageRanges.cs
- HeaderPanel.cs
- ByteStream.cs
- FixedSOMLineRanges.cs
- EllipseGeometry.cs
- ImmutablePropertyDescriptorGridEntry.cs
- StateMachineSubscription.cs
- SplitterEvent.cs
- LazyLoadBehavior.cs
- XmlSchemaGroup.cs
- SafeHandles.cs
- Funcletizer.cs
- ApplicationGesture.cs
- BasePattern.cs
- InstanceDataCollection.cs
- SerialStream.cs
- GridViewDeleteEventArgs.cs
- DocumentSequence.cs
- WinEventQueueItem.cs
- FlowDocument.cs
- MethodCallTranslator.cs
- UserMapPath.cs
- PrimaryKeyTypeConverter.cs
- IBuiltInEvidence.cs
- PropertyPath.cs
- WaitForChangedResult.cs
- ComplexPropertyEntry.cs
- RealizationContext.cs
- PersonalizationDictionary.cs
- HtmlElementErrorEventArgs.cs
- UncommonField.cs
- Properties.cs
- UserMapPath.cs
- FixUp.cs
- ResponseStream.cs
- PerfCounterSection.cs
- DataGridViewAutoSizeModeEventArgs.cs
- CompatibleComparer.cs
- input.cs
- MsmqTransportSecurityElement.cs
- DataListItemCollection.cs
- TypeValidationEventArgs.cs
- RangeValidator.cs
- cookiecontainer.cs
- HitTestParameters.cs
- SizeAnimationClockResource.cs
- CodeTypeReferenceCollection.cs
- cryptoapiTransform.cs
- GetPageNumberCompletedEventArgs.cs
- InternalPolicyElement.cs
- PersonalizationState.cs
- WebHttpSecurityElement.cs
- Vector3DAnimationUsingKeyFrames.cs
- RecognitionEventArgs.cs
- PerspectiveCamera.cs
- _ListenerRequestStream.cs
- WebPartTransformerAttribute.cs
- SafeCryptHandles.cs